One of the primary reasons for applying bookkeeping in building projects is the need for economic control and administration. Accountancy systems give real-time understandings right into project prices, income, and productivity, allowing task managers to promptly recognize possible problems and take corrective actions.


Bookkeeping systems enable firms to monitor money circulations in real-time, making sure adequate funds are available to cover costs and fulfill financial obligations. Reliable capital administration helps stop liquidity crises and maintains the job on track. https://hearthis.at/leonel-centeno/set/pvm-accounting/. Building and construction jobs undergo numerous monetary requireds and coverage needs. Proper accounting guarantees that all financial transactions are tape-recorded accurately which the project abides by accountancy requirements and contractual agreements.

A Building and construction Accountant is accountable for managing the financial aspects of building and construction tasks, including budgeting, price tracking, financial reporting, and conformity with regulatory requirements. They function carefully with project managers, specialists, and stakeholders to guarantee precise monetary documents, expense controls, and prompt settlements. Their knowledge in building accountancy concepts, task setting you back, and financial analysis is necessary for effective monetary monitoring within the construction market.

As you've probably discovered now, tax obligations are an unavoidable component of doing company in the USA. While the majority of focus generally lies on government and state revenue taxes, there's also a 3rd aspectpayroll taxes. Payroll taxes are tax obligations on a worker's gross wage. The revenues from pay-roll tax obligations are used to money public programs; because of this, the funds gathered go straight to those programs as opposed to the Internal Earnings Service (INTERNAL REVENUE SERVICE).


Note that there is an added 0.9% tax for high-income earnersmarried taxpayers that make over $250,000 or single taxpayers making over $200,000. Revenues from this tax obligation go toward federal and state unemployment funds to aid employees who have actually lost their jobs.

Your deposits have to be made either on a regular monthly or semi-weekly schedulean election you make prior to each fiscal year. Monthly payments. A month-to-month settlement should be made by the 15th of the following look at here month. Semi-weekly repayments. Every various other week deposit days depend upon your pay schedule. If your payday falls on a Wednesday, Thursday or Friday, your deposit schedules Wednesday of the complying with week.


Take care of your obligationsand your employeesby making full pay-roll tax obligation repayments on time. Collection and payment aren't your only tax obligation obligations.

Keep in mind that depending upon the kind of business you run, you may file an alternate form. For example, a farm utilizes Type 943 rather of Kind 941. financial reports. FUTA tax obligations are reported yearly using Type 940, Company's Annual Federal Joblessness (FUTA) Tax Return. Yearly's return schedules by January 31 of the following year.


Every state has its very own unemployment tax (called SUTA or UI). This is because your company's industry, years in service and unemployment background can all determine the percentage used to compute the quantity due.
